VCSA 6.5 update fails with “vix error codes = (1, 4294967294)”

Last week I performed a VCSA upgrade from 6.0U2 to the latest 6.5 version. Already in Stage 1, where I needed to connect to the source appliance I got the error “A problem occurred while getting data from the source vCenter Server” from the installer (like you can see on the screenshot).

The attached log file showed the following line at the end:

2017-12-14T09:30:28.673Z – error: sourcePrecheck: error in getting source Info: ServerFaultCode: A general system error occurred: vix error codes = (1, 4294967294)

It turned out that this error was related to a root password of the old appliance, which was about to expire (but didn´t so far). Anyway, the easy workaround here was just to change the root password on the old appliance to a new one. Durring the process of the installer you are asked for a “new” root password for the new VCSA appliance anyway, so you can directly use the old password again if you like to.
Maybe also a good time to consider disabling the root password expiration after the update, if you run into the same problem.

